New member here. I recently inherited a 1967 Sheridan Blue Streek, a 1987 Diana model 36, a 1971 S&W 79G, and a 1968 Daisy VL. The Sheridan got a new set of seals after hitting my doorstep, the 79G has a new set of seals waiting to be put in, and the model 36 has been shooting fairly well - although inconsistent (maybe it's me... maybe). I gotta say I'm having a blast with them. Older pumpers and springers are a riot and a challenge all at the same time.
I stopped by the Baldwinsville, NY show last weekend. There was a nice group of folks there and some great vendors. Shooting seemed to be limited to testing only, but it was good to see a few guns in action.
